Ryanair flight delay - can I claim accommodation and compensation?

My flight was delayed 16 hours, we were told we could find our own hotels which I did and paid £100. Can I claim both this and £220 compensation for the delay? And if so how - I went via their online form and claimed the £100, I wasn't clear if this was claiming the compensation as well?

Yes - your delay compensation under UK261 separate from getting food/accommodation expenses reimbursed. There should be an MSE page about getting your UK261 compensation. Google is your friend.0
-
Ah, thanks. Found it. Sadly it says I'm not eligible. The long delay was caused by crewing issues, but they said the initial 90 minute delay was due to a bird strike which had a knock-on effect so no compensation is due. So be it.1
-
Eligibility for compensation will depend on the reason for the delay, so isn't payable if the reason was extraordinary circumstances outside the airline's control, whereas the separate claim for accommodation (and meal) expenses isn't conditional on the delay reason.Ash_Pole said:Sorry this is going to sound like a daft question but I can't seem to find this information.
